West Virginia's structural steel fabricators form the backbone of regional construction supply. The state is home to AISC-certified shops that specialize in building frames, bridge components, industrial platforms, and heavy-duty warehouse systems. These manufacturers work directly from engineer drawings and can handle complex bolt patterns, field connections, and site-specific modifications—capabilities that generic commodity suppliers cannot match.
AISC certification means the shop has undergone rigorous audits on welding procedures, material traceability, and quality control. For construction procurement teams, this certification dramatically reduces your need for third-party inspection and expedites approval cycles. West Virginia shops like those in the Huntington and Charleston districts maintain standing relationships with regional structural engineering firms and general contractors, so they understand the nuances of building codes, load calculations, and change order management.

Custom Fasteners and Assembly for Construction Applications
Beyond structural steel, West Virginia manufacturers produce high-strength fasteners, anchor bolts, and assembly kits tailored to construction specifications. Shops in the state specialize in batch production of custom-length bolts (meeting ASTM A325, A490 standards), welded stud assemblies, and pre-assembled connection kits that reduce on-site labor and improve safety. For modular construction and prefabricated building systems—a growing segment in commercial real estate—these component packages cut project timelines by 20-30%.
West Virginia fastener manufacturers maintain inventory of common grades (Grade 5, Grade 8, stainless) and can produce specialty alloys for corrosion resistance in bridge work or seismic applications. Quality documentation, material certs, and traceability records are standard—not added cost. Many shops have invested in automated assembly lines that ensure consistency across large orders while maintaining the flexibility to handle custom configurations.

Metal Roofing and Architectural Components
West Virginia's construction manufacturers have expanded into architectural metalwork and metal roofing systems—segments with strong margins and rising demand in commercial and institutional building. Shops produce standing seam roofing, metal wall panels, custom fascia, and specialty trim that meet building code wind and load requirements while offering aesthetic customization. These components are manufactured to tight tolerances and often require pre-drilling, notching, and surface finishing that would be cost-prohibitive if sourced overseas.
The state's manufacturers have expertise in both cold-formed and hot-rolled metal systems and can work with aluminum, galvanized steel, and weathering steel. For green building certifications (LEED, Living Building Challenge), local sourcing reduces embodied carbon in the supply chain and is increasingly a procurement requirement. Architectural metalwork shops in the Charleston and Huntington areas maintain relationships with architects and building envelope consultants, so they can advise on design-for-manufacturability and optimize component costs.

Heavy Equipment and Specialty Fabrication for Infrastructure Projects
West Virginia's manufacturing ecosystem includes shops equipped for heavy fabrication work—temporary bridge systems, formwork, heavy lifting equipment components, and specialized infrastructure gear. These facilities have invested in large-format welding, heavy plate machining, and assembly capabilities required for one-off or low-volume infrastructure components. The New River Gorge Bridge renovation and ongoing highway modernization projects have generated consistent demand for this specialized capacity.
Shops capable of heavy fabrication typically maintain ASME Section VIII certification (pressure vessel and structural standards) and employ welders qualified on carbon steel, stainless, and specialty alloys. They can handle projects involving large-scale machining, precision boring, and complex assembly sequences. For infrastructure procurement teams, working with these verified specialists eliminates the risk of underestimating project complexity and ensures timeline predictability.

The most critical certifications for construction manufacturing are ISO 9001 (quality management and process control), AWS D1.1 (welding standards for structural steel), and AISC (American Institute of Steel Construction structural steel certification). For pressure vessels or specialized equipment, ASME Section VIII certification is essential. Many WV shops also maintain OSHA 10/30 safety certifications and material test lab accreditation. ISO 9001-certified WV manufacturers employ documented quality procedures that include incoming material inspection, in-process testing, final dimensional verification, and traceability records for every component. For welded assemblies, this means documented welding procedures, welder qualifications (AWS D1.1), and mechanical testing of sample welds. For fasteners and machined parts, coordinate measuring machines (CMM) verify dimensions to print specifications. Most shops maintain material test lab accreditation or work with certified labs to provide mill certs for steel and alloys. Documentation packages (test reports, dimensional certs, material origin) accompany every shipment.
